之前教过大家利用基于 ChatGLM-6B 搭建个人专属知识库实现个人专属知识库,非常简单易上手。最近,智谱 AI 研发团队又推出了 ChatGLM 系列的新模型 ChatGLM2-6B,是开源中英双语对话模型 ChatGLM-6B 的第二代版本,性能更强悍。树先生之所以现在才更新 ChatGLM2-6B 知识库教程,是想等模型本身再多迭代几个版本,...
ChatGLM2-6B 使用了GLM的混合目标函数,经过了 1.4T 中英标识符的预训练与人类偏好对齐训练,评测结果显示,相比于初代模型,ChatGLM2-6B 在 MMLU(+23%)、CEval(+33%)、GSM8K(+571%) 、BBH(+60%)等数据集上的性能取得了大幅度的提升,在同尺寸开源模型中具有较强的竞争力。 更长的上下文:基于FlashAttention...
“经过前期的探索和准备,我们终于迈出了第一步:使用ChatGPT和 LangChain这些强大的工具,初步完成了专属知识库的搭建。” 01 — 继昨天部署 ChatGLM2-6B 成功后,工程落地实践|国产大模型 ChatGLM2-6B 阿里云上部署成功,今天继续向“专属知识库”的目标前进。 在成功部署 ChatGPT 模型的基础上,用咱们国产...
cdChatGLM2-6B# 其中 transformers 库版本推荐为 4.30.2,torch 推荐使用 2.0 及以上的版本,以获得最佳的推理性能pip install -r requirements.txt 下载模型 # 这里我将下载的模型文件放到了本地的 chatglm-6b 目录下git clone https://huggingface.co/THUDM/chatglm2-6b$PWD/chatglm2-6b 参数调整 # 因为前...
随着人工智能技术的不断发展,我们可以利用先进的工具来搭建个人专属知识库,提高知识管理的效率和便捷性。本文将介绍如何使用LangChain和ChatGLM2-6B这两个强大的工具,实现个人知识库的搭建与应用。 一、LangChain与ChatGLM2-6B简介 LangChain是一个开源的自然语言处理框架,它提供了丰富的工具和API,方便开发者进行自然...
简介:之前教过大家利用 langchain + ChatGLM-6B 实现个人专属知识库,非常简单易上手。最近,智谱 AI 研发团队又推出了 ChatGLM 系列的新模型 ChatGLM2-6B,是开源中英双语对话模型 ChatGLM-6B 的第二代版本,性能更强悍。树先生之所以现在才更新 ChatGLM2-6B 知识库教程,是想等模型本身再多迭代几个版本,不至于...
LangChain-Chatchat默认使用的 LLM 模型为 THUDM/chatglm2-6b,默认使用的 Embedding 模型为 moka-ai/m3e-base 为例。 3.1、LLM 模型支持 目前最新的版本中基于 FastChat 进行本地 LLM 模型接入,目前已经正式接入支持的模型达30+,具体清单如下: meta-llama/Llama-2-7b-chat-hf ...
私有AI知识库的价值巨大。不管是个人、企业或者行业,都可以用它来打造定制化的垂直智库。基于AI大模型的能力,知识的检索和应用将变得异常简单。目前很多行业都在探索落地,比如AI客服、AI导诊、AI法律助手等。 在上两篇文章中,介绍了如何利用白嫖阿里云服务器,DIY部署AI大模型ChatGLM2-6b;以及大模型的进阶,如何基于P...
本文将以ChatGLM-6B为例,介绍如何结合LangChain开源框架,搭建个人专属知识库,并探讨其在实际应用中的优势。 一、ChatGLM-6B简介 ChatGLM-6B是基于Transformer架构的国产大型语言模型,拥有60亿参数。该模型在训练过程中学习了大量文本数据,能够理解和生成自然语言文本。ChatGLM-6B在语义理解、文本生成和对话系统等方面...
ChatGLM2模型+Langchain知识库挂载 经过上文介绍,在中文能力测评中,ChatGLM2-6B 是众多大模型中表现较好的一个,同时 由于其发布时间较早,投资者对于它的认知程度也更高。我们此处以该模型为例进行部署 和 Langchain 知识库的挂载介绍。我们推荐首先使用模型 Github 官方项目的代码进行部署,在 web_demo.py 中...